daniel-nagy / md-data-table

Material Design Data Table for Angular Material
MIT License
1.9k stars 518 forks source link

Google Chrome Version 65.0.3325.146 does not render > 1 column #636

Open NMVW opened 6 years ago

NMVW commented 6 years ago

Using ng-repeat with md-table directives, i have columns rendering when running Chrome < 65.0 but disappearing when running Version 65.0.

table(ng-if="table.scenario.loadcaseIds.length > 0" md-table flex="grow" md-progress='promise').flexible-columns
      colgroup
        col(
          ng-repeat="loadcase in table.scenarioLoadcases"
          span=1
        )
      thead(md-head md-order='query.order' md-on-reorder='logOrder')
        tr(md-row)
          th(
            md-column
            ng-class="{active: loadcase.id === table.highlightedLoadcaseId, selected: table.selectedLoadcaseIds.includes(loadcase.id), invalid: table.invalidLoadcaseIds.includes(loadcase.id)}"
            ng-repeat="loadcase in table.scenarioLoadcases"
            ng-mouseenter="table.hoverLoadcase(loadcase.id, true)"
            ng-mouseleave="table.hoverLoadcase(loadcase.id, false)"
          ).loadcase
            span(
              ng-click="table.editLoadcase(loadcase)"
            ).md-icon-button {{loadcase.name}}
              md-tooltip(ng-if="!table.disabled" md-direction="top") Edit Loadcase
            md-button(
              ng-click="table.toggleSelectedLoadcase(loadcase.id)"
            ).md-button.md-icon-button
              md-icon.visibility.small visibility
              md-tooltip(md-direction="right") Toggle Loadcase
            md-button(
            ng-click="table.deleteLoadcase(loadcase)"
            ng-if="!table.disabled"
            ng-hide="table.scenario.homogenization_state"
            ).md-icon-button.md-warn
              md-icon.small.delete remove_circle_outline
              md-tooltip(md-direction="right") Delete Loadcase